当前位置:高等教育资讯网  >  中国高校课件下载中心  >  大学文库  >  浏览文档

《微机原理》课程电子教案(PPT课件讲稿)第九章 串行通信接口及其应用

资源类别:文库,文档格式:PPT,文档页数:31,文件大小:145KB,团购合买
第九章 串行通信接口及其应用 一、概述 1、通信:计算机与外部的信息交换 2、通信方式:并行与串行通信 3、串行优势:利用现有信道。长距离传输
点击下载完整版文档(PPT)

串行通信接口 及其应用 概述 通信:计算机与外部的信息交换 通信方式:并行与串行通信 串行优势:利用现有信道。长距离传输

串行通信接口 及其应用 • 概述—— • 通信:计算机与外部的信息交换 • 通信方式:并行与串行通信 • 串行优势:利用现有信道。长距离传输

串行通信接口 及其应用 9.1—异步通信接口 1)串行通信基本概念 异步通信:无公共时标 串行通信 同步通信:有公共时标

串行通信接口 及其应用 • 9 .1 ——异步通信接口 • 1)串行通信基本概念 串行通信 异步通信:无公共时标 同步通信:有公共时标

串行通信接口 及其应用 9.1—异步通信接口 1)串行通信基本概念—异步与同步 异步通信的数据格式 起始位 数据位 奇偶校验位停止位

串行通信接口 及其应用 • 9 .1 ——异步通信接口 • 1)串行通信基本概念——异步与同步 • 异步通信的数据格式 起始位 数据位 奇偶校验位 停止位

串行通信接口 及其应用 9.1—异步通信接口 1)串行通信基本概念—异步与同步 同步通信方式 开始标志地址场控制场数据场「校验码结束标志 SDLC/HDLO同步规程,数据帧

串行通信接口 及其应用 • 9 .1 ——异步通信接口 • 1)串行通信基本概念——异步与同步 • 同步通信方式 开始标志 数据场 校验码 SDLC/HDLC同步规程,数据帧 地址场 控制场 结束标志

串行通信接口 及其应用 9.1—异步通信接口 ·1)串行通信基本概念—异步与同步 校验码 奇偶校验: 奇校验:校验位=a1+a2+~an+ 偶校验:校验位=a1+a2+~an 发送方 接收方接收错误: 10001110 110011110 用奇校验 接收方接收错误: 则p=1+1+1+1=0 010111110 接收方正确接收: 能判断奇数个数据出错 010001110 不能判断偶数个数据出错

串行通信接口 及其应用 • 9 .1 ——异步通信接口 • 1)串行通信基本概念——异步与同步 • 校验码 • 奇偶校验: 奇校验:校验位=a1+a2+~an+1 偶校验:校验位=a1+a2+~an 发送方 10001110 用奇校验 则p=1+1+1+1=0 接收方正确接收: 010001110 接收方接收错误: 110011110 接收方接收错误: 010111110 只能判断奇数个数据出错 不能判断偶数个数据出错

串行通信接口 及其应用 9.1—异步通信接口 ·1)串行通信基本概念—异步与同步 校验码 循环校验CRC码:在K位信息码后拼接R位 校验码。可发现并纠正错误。 模2运算 0+0=0,0+1=1,1+0=0,1+1=0

串行通信接口 及其应用 • 9 .1 ——异步通信接口 • 1)串行通信基本概念——异步与同步 • 校验码 • 循环校验CRC码:在K位信息码后拼接R位 校验码。可发现并纠正错误。 • 模2运算 • 0+0=0,0+1=1,1+0=0,1+1=0

串行通信接口 及其应用 模2运算 0+0=0,0+1=1,1+0=0,1+1=0 101 10110000 101 010 000 100 101

串行通信接口 及其应用 模2运算 • 0+0=0,0+1=1,1+0=0,1+1=0 • • 101 101 10000 101 010 000 100 101 01

串行通信接口 及其应用 循环校验CRC码: 设信息长度为K的信息码对应多项式为: M(X)=MKIXK-+MK2XK-2+-MX +Mo 附加R位后生成N位循环码。设生成多项式为G(X) 则M(X)=MK1XK1+M K-2XK-2 ++MIX+M 附加R位后,得到N位循环码,其生成多项式为G(X) 有:M(X)Xr=Q(X)+R(X) G(X G(X) ·N位的循环冗余码CRC码: C(X)=M(XX +R(X)

串行通信接口 及其应用 • 循环校验CRC码: • 设信息长度为K的信息码对应多项式为: • M(X)=MK-1XK-1+MK-2XK-2+~+M1X1+M0 • 附加R位后生成N位循环码。设生成多项式为G(X) • 则 M(X)=M K-1 X K-1 +M K-2 X K-2 +~+M1X1 +M0 附加R位后,得到N位循环码,其生成多项式为G(X) • 有:M(X)X r =Q(X)+R(X) • N位的循环冗余码CRC码: • C(X)=M(X)X r +R(X) G(X) G(X)

串行通信接口 及其应用 循环校验CRC码: CRC码校验原理 发送时,CRC生成器由输出的数据信息和 (X)计算出CRC码。附在数据串后发送出去。 接收时,数据串和CRC码一起被读出,送到 接受设备的CRC生成器进行计算。 若C(X)/G(X)=0,则无错 否则,出错。由循环规律可确定出错位并加 以纠正

串行通信接口 及其应用 循环校验CRC码: CRC码校验原理 发送时,CRC生成器由输出的数据信息和 (X)计算出CRC码。附在数据串后发送出去。 接收时,数据串和CRC码一起被读出,送到 接受设备的CRC生成器进行计算。 若C(X)/G(X)=0,则无错 否则,出错。由循环规律可确定出错位并加 以纠正

串行通信接口 及其应用 循环校验CRC码: 例:4位有效信息1100,求CRC码。 生成多项式为:G(X)=1011 M(X)=X3+x2=1100 M(X)X3=X6X9=1100000 G(X)=X+X+1=1011 M(X)X3=1100000=1110+010 G(Ⅹ) 1011 1011 M(X)X+R(X)=1100000+010=1100010

串行通信接口 及其应用 循环校验CRC码: 例:4位有效信息1100,求CRC码。 生成多项式为:G(X)=1011 M(X)=X +X =1100 M(X)X =X +X =1100000 G(X)=X +X +1=1011 M(X)X =1100000 =1110+ 010 M(X)X +R(X)=1100000+010=1100010 3 2 3 6 5 2 3 3 G(X) 1011 1011

点击下载完整版文档(PPT)VIP每日下载上限内不扣除下载券和下载次数;
按次数下载不扣除下载券;
24小时内重复下载只扣除一次;
顺序:VIP每日次数-->可用次数-->下载券;
共31页,可试读12页,点击继续阅读 ↓↓
相关文档

关于我们|帮助中心|下载说明|相关软件|意见反馈|联系我们

Copyright © 2008-现在 cucdc.com 高等教育资讯网 版权所有